Operational features

What Teams Actually Do in OreLynx

From assigning field work to verifying corrective action, OreLynx gives every operational record a responsible person, current state, evidence requirement and review history.

01

Plan field work

Create versioned work packs with forms, maps, reference data, locations, assignees and required evidence.

02

Work and sync offline

Capture observations, coordinates, media and samples without a live connection; surface duplicates and conflicts for review.

03

Control samples and laboratory handoffs

Issue sample identifiers, record custody transfers, reconcile submissions and route results and QA/QC exceptions.

04

Track rights and obligations

Connect mineral rights, due dates, accountable owners, reminders, submissions and completion evidence.

05

Investigate and close actions

Move incidents, findings and commitments through investigation, corrective action, returned evidence and independent verification.

06

Approve and report from source

Run role-based review, preserve decision history and produce authorised reports with drill-back to the supporting record.

07

Control access across organisations

Separate tenants, sites, clients and programme participants while recording delegated access, expiry and revocation.

08

Export and integrate safely

Exchange governed records, reconcile failures and deliver verified customer-controlled exports without replacing specialist systems.
